Adafruit Electret Microphone Amplifier, compatible with Arduino and Raspberry Pi. Accessory type: Sensor control, equipped with the Maxim MAX4466 chipset. This microphone, with a frequency range of 20-20 kHz, is a breakout board that is ideal for audio projects. Develop exciting audio projects with the Electret Microphone Amplifier MAX4466 breakout board for your Arduino development board. The microphone is suitable for capturing sounds in the range of 20 Hz to 20 kHz. You can use it for voice modulation, audio recordings, and sampling applications, as well as for audio-reactive projects.
